Memorial Donations Stolen From Grieving Greeley Family

GREELEY, Colo. (CBS4) - A grieving family in Greeley is devastated after someone stole donations meant for them, possibly during a funeral for three relatives.

On Jan. 25 Gilbert Martinez, his wife Mistelle Martinez and the couple's two young sons were hit by a suspected drunk driver on Highway 85. That driver crossed the median and hit their vehicle head on and was killed in the accident. Gilbert and the two boys -- Ethan and Bryson -- died.

"We all gathered at the Greeley hospital emergency area and we did find out at that time that both his younger sons had passed away in this accident," Gilbert's uncle Frank Martinez said.

Mistelle Martinez was left to plan a memorial for her own family. It was held last Friday at the Faith Tabernacle Church, and hundreds of people showed up.

"There were people who had sat in every seat of the sanctuary, and there were also folding chairs that were put out that people filled and also people standing in the foyer and people outside," Frank Martinez told CBS4.

Baskets full of cards and donations were also left for the family in the entryway. The church pastor said at one point during the service the baskets were overflowing. And then, suddenly, they were gone.

"We've searched high and low, and considering the days that have gone by it's pointing more in that direction that someone did go into the service and steal the cards and the money that was in them," Martinez said. "It's kind of a feeling of being kicked while you're down and just unimaginable that somebody would do something like that.

"Especially at a funeral. Especially after the loss that we suffered."

The family is hoping now that whomever is responsible will have a change of heart.

Greeley police are asking that because of the theft anyone who may have written a check for the family to cancel it. They are also asking that those who may have done so to keep an eye on their accounts and report anything suspicious to their office.
